0 Likes
Panoram in San Cristobal hill, located in downtown Santiago de Chile, with an altitude of 880 meters over sea, is an excellent place for trekking and mountain bike, also can ride by car or funicular.
The Sanctuary of the Immaculate Conception located at the top of the hill was inaugurated on April 26, 1908.